Texas Code § 451.552

ADDITION OF MUNICIPALITY BY ELECTION
Open in Lexace · Ask the AI about this section
Sec. 451.552. ADDITION OF MUNICIPALITY BY ELECTION. (a) The territory of a municipality that is not a part of an authority may be added to an authority if:
(1) any part of the municipality is located in a county, or in any county adjacent to a county, in which the authority is located;
(2) the governing body of the municipality orders an election under this section on whether the territory of the municipality should be added to the authority; and
(3) a majority of the votes received in the election favor the measure.
(b) The governing body of the municipality shall certify to the authority the result of an election in which the addition is approved.
